This one day course provides an advanced update for delegates who have previously attended our one day Caldicott Guardian Training.
The course is aimed at experienced Caldicott Guardians, their deputies and others, involved in applying the Caldicott Principles across a wide range of organisations.
The course will include latest updates, advanced case studies and an opportunity to discuss the issues you are facing in Caldicott Decision making in your practice. A range of topics are covered including: the ethical and legal considerations in information sharing, confidentiality, handling requests from the Police, domestic violence, relatives, assurance and the regulators. Handouts, Templates and other tools for decision making and recording decisions are provided. Christopher Fincken, Member UK Caldicott Guardian Council, (Former Chair) facilitates the course, and brings over 20 years of personal experience of leading innovations in the application of the Caldicott Principles.
Facilitated by Christopher Fincken Independent Member and Former Chair UK Caldicott Guardian Council, this interesting and informative course is fully interactive. Participants in small groups will face a number of case study challenges throughout the day building personal knowledge, understanding and confidence.
